How they compare
France currently reports 0.9% against 0.8% in Madagascar, a difference of 0.1%.
That makes France's figure about 1.1 times Madagascar's.
The two have swapped places 12 times across 26 shared years of data; in 2000 it was France ahead.
France ranks 144th and Madagascar ranks 147th of 200 countries.
France has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| France | Madagascar |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.3% | -0.3% | 0.6% | France |
| 2010s | 1.1% | -0.4% | 1.5% | France |
| 2020s | 0.1% | -0.6% | 0.7% | France |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
